FRANKFURT, Germany -- Schalke fell to a fifth straight loss for its worst start in a Bundesliga season after wasting an early lead and having a penalty denied in stoppage time to go down 2-1 at Hoffenheim on Sunday.Hoffenheim earned its first win of the season after four straight draws when Lukas Rupp netted the winning goal in the 41st. Earlier, Andrej Kramaric had canceled out Eric Maxim Choupo-Motings goal in the fourth.Deep into stoppage time, the ball hit the arm of Hoffenheims Kerem Demirbay, but calls for a penalty were ignored.It was clearly a hand ball, said Hoffenheim coach Julian Nagelsmann.But Schalke players refused to blame the referee for the loss.It wasnt the referee, we lost it today, captain Benedikt Hoewedes said. We are making too many mistakes and thats what happens when you dont have confidence.The defeat increases the pressure on Schalkes new coach, Markus Weinzierl, who was brought in with a reputation as one of the most talented young coaches in Germany.Schalke was also one of the busiest clubs on the transfer market but the new signings have failed to make an impact so far. Central defender Naldo was left on the bench, with Matija Nastasic taking his place. Nastasic was outplayed on both Hoffenheim goals.I dont know what the problem is, but its getting tougher and tougher every week, said Schalke goalkeeper Ralf Faehrmann.---COLOGNE 1, RB LEIPZIG 1Despite a hostile reception, newcomer Leipzig earned a 1-1 draw in Cologne as both teams stayed undefeated.Cologne fans blocked the bus bringing the Leipzig team to the stadium and the match kicked off 15 minutes late. NEW YORK -- NBCs coverage of the Rio Olympics on Sunday included controversy over a commentator comment and some harrowing video of the treacherous cycling road race. A look at the Rio Olympics through a media lens:SECOND THOUGHTS: With live TV, NBC swimming commentator Dan Hicks said Sunday, there are often times you look back and wish you had said things differently. He spoke less than 24 hours after being criticized for calling the coach and husband of Hungarian swimmer Katinka Hosszu the guy responsible for a career turnaround that led to her gold medal swim on Saturday. Hicks said it was impossible to tell Hosszus story without citing the work of coach Shane Tusup. Online critics said it was sexist to give so much praise to a male coach for a female athletes performance.ROUGH RIDE: The heart-stopping womens cycling race, won at the last moment by Dutch rider Anna van der Breggen, was expertly called Sunday afternoon by NBCs team of Paul Sherwen and Christian Vande Velde. While they sometimes get lost in the weeds of their sports technicalities, the two men skillfully anticipated key moments. Vande Velde nnoted ahead of time that American rider Mara Abbott, who had a large lead but was caught at the end, was better on the mountains than the level course where the race concluded.dddddddddddd Earlier, he predicted a high probability of broken bones during a rain-slicked mountain descent on a course where several men had crashed a day earlier. Moments later, cameras caught the frightening wipeout of Dutch rider Annemiek van Vleuten, the races leader at the time.RATINGS: NBC averaged 20.7 million viewers Saturday for its first night of Olympics prime-time competition. Like with Fridays opening ceremony, it was a smaller audience than for the London games in 2012 (which had 27.3 million viewers for the corresponding night). NBC said part of the reason the prime-time numbers are down is because viewers are streaming Olympics coverage on portable devices. Also, the Nielsen company said 2.2 million viewers watched prime-time Olympics programming on the NBCSN and Bravo cable networks Saturday.
